推荐开源项目:Tapiriik,保持你的健身同步不掉队!

推荐开源项目:Tapiriik,保持你的健身同步不掉队!

tapiriiktapiriik keeps your fitness in sync项目地址:https://gitcode.com/gh_mirrors/ta/tapiriik

在数字化的今天,我们依赖各种健身应用来追踪和记录运动成果。然而,这些数据往往被孤立在各个平台之间,难以整合分析。幸运的是,有一个名为Tapiriik的开源项目,致力于解决这个问题,让你的健身活动数据畅通无阻地跨平台同步。

1、项目介绍

Tapiriik是一个智能的健身同步工具,它自动将你的跑步、骑行、瑜伽等各类运动数据从一个服务无缝地转移到另一个服务。无论你是使用Strava、Endomondo还是其他健身应用,都能确保信息的准确性和一致性。只需访问tapiriik.com,一切变得简单易行。

2、项目技术分析

Tapiriik采用Python编写,通过精心设计的API接口与各大健身服务平台进行交互。其内部实现包括:

  • 自动发现和配置:Tapiriik能够自动检测并连接到你的健身账户。
  • 灵活的数据转换系统: Tapiriik理解每个服务的数据模型,并能将其转化为其他服务可以理解的形式。
  • 异步处理:为了提供良好的用户体验,它采用了异步处理机制,即使面对大量数据也能高效运行。

3、项目及技术应用场景

无论你是专业运动员还是健身爱好者,都可以利用Tapiriik来:

  • 统一管理数据:在一个平台上就能查看所有运动记录,无需频繁切换应用。
  • 比较不同服务的统计结果:了解哪个平台对某项运动的记录更精确。
  • 备份重要数据:防止因某个服务故障而丢失宝贵的健身历史记录。

对于开发者来说,Tapiriik的技术可以用于:

  • 学习跨平台同步策略:深入了解如何实现复杂数据的迁移。
  • 构建自己的健身应用:借鉴Tapiriik的数据处理和转换框架。

4、项目特点

  • 强大兼容性:支持多个主流健身应用,如Strava、Runkeeper和Garmin Connect等。
  • 自动化同步:设置一次后,数据同步自动化进行,无需手动操作。
  • 安全可靠:Tapiriik严格遵守各服务商的安全协议,保证用户数据的安全。
  • 开放源码:Apache 2.0 许可证下的开源项目,鼓励社区参与开发和改进。

总的来说,Tapiriik是一个必备的工具,如果你希望让健身数据流动起来,不妨试试这个项目。无论是个人使用还是开发学习,它都会给你带来惊喜。现在就加入,让健身变得更智能、更便捷!

tapiriiktapiriik keeps your fitness in sync项目地址:https://gitcode.com/gh_mirrors/ta/tapiriik

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

廉欣盼Industrious

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值